What is a rooming house?
A rooming house or boarding house is a building in which four or more people, who are not related to the landlord, have separate agreements to pay rent.
By law rooming houses must be registered with the local council and meet health and safety standards.
Everyone has the right to live in clean and safe accommodation. |
